Introduction to ISO 27001 Lead Auditor Training

ISO 27001 Lead Auditor Training is designed for professionals who want to develop expertise in auditing information security management systems (ISMS). This training equips participants with the knowledge and practical skills required to assess an organization’s compliance with ISO 27001 standards. It focuses on risk management, security controls, audit planning, and reporting techniques. As organizations increasingly rely on digital systems, trained lead auditors play a crucial role in safeguarding sensitive data and ensuring regulatory compliance.

Key Topics Covered in ISO 27001 Lead Auditor Training

The training program covers a wide range of topics to ensure comprehensive understanding. Participants learn about ISO 27001 requirements, risk assessment methods, audit principles, and the structure of an effective ISMS. The course also includes practical guidance on audit planning, conducting internal and external audits, preparing audit reports, and managing audit teams. Real-world case studies and practical exercises help learners apply theoretical knowledge to actual workplace scenarios.
